2020 Toyota Yaris Cross (XP210) 1.5 (116 Hp) Hybrid E-Four ECVT

The Toyota Yaris Cross (XP210) is a subcompact crossover SUV introduced by Toyota in August 2020. Positioned as the SUV counterpart to the Yaris hatchback, the Yaris Cross aims to capitalize on the growing demand for smaller, more fuel-efficient, and versatile vehicles, particularly within the European market. While not initially sold in the United States, it represents Toyota’s strategy to expand its hybrid and all-wheel-drive offerings in a competitive segment. The XP210 generation features a hybrid powertrain and available all-wheel drive (E-Four) configuration, making it a practical choice for urban and suburban driving.

Toyota Yaris Cross (XP210): An Overview

The Yaris Cross is built on the Toyota New Global Architecture (TNGA-B) platform, shared with the latest Yaris hatchback. This platform contributes to the vehicle’s improved rigidity, handling, and safety features. The vehicle is primarily marketed in Europe and Japan, where demand for compact crossovers is high. It bridges the gap between the standard Yaris and larger Toyota C-HR, offering a more spacious and practical option for families and individuals seeking a versatile vehicle.

Engine & Performance

The Yaris Cross XP210 1.5 Hybrid E-Four utilizes Toyota’s fourth-generation hybrid technology. The powertrain combines a 1.5-liter, three-cylinder M15A-FXE gasoline engine with an electric motor. The gasoline engine produces 91 horsepower at 5500 rpm and 120 Nm (88.51 lb-ft) of torque between 3800-4800 rpm. This is paired with two electric motors – one driving the front wheels with 80 horsepower and 141 Nm (104 lb-ft) of torque, and a smaller 5 horsepower motor driving the rear axle with 52 Nm (38.35 lb-ft) of torque. The combined system output is 116 horsepower.

Power is delivered to all four wheels via an electronically controlled continuously variable transmission (ECVT). This configuration allows for both full electric driving at low speeds and a blended hybrid mode for optimal fuel efficiency. The E-Four system intelligently distributes torque between the front and rear axles, enhancing stability and traction in various driving conditions. Fuel economy is a key strength, with combined figures ranging from 3.5 to 3.8 liters per 100 kilometers (67.2 – 61.9 US mpg or 80.7 – 74.3 UK mpg). The weight-to-power ratio is 10.8 kg/Hp, and the weight-to-torque ratio is 10.4 kg/Nm.

Design & Features

The Yaris Cross boasts a compact SUV body style with a length of 4180 mm (164.57 in) and a width of 1765 mm (69.49 in). Its design incorporates styling cues from the larger Toyota RAV4 and C-HR, featuring a bold front grille, sculpted body lines, and a distinctive rear end. The interior offers seating for five passengers and provides a practical cargo space.

Key features include a touchscreen infotainment system, smartphone integration (Apple CarPlay and Android Auto), and a suite of advanced safety technologies. These safety features typically include Toyota Safety Sense, which encompasses pre-collision system with pedestrian and cyclist detection, lane departure alert with steering assist, adaptive cruise control, and road sign assist. The vehicle’s relatively high ride height (170 mm / 6.69 in) enhances visibility and provides a more commanding driving position. The Yaris Cross is designed with practicality in mind, offering a comfortable and versatile interior for everyday use.

Technical Specifications

Brand Toyota
Model Yaris Cross
Generation Yaris Cross (XP210)
Type (Engine) 1.5 (116 Hp) Hybrid E-Four ECVT
Start of production August, 2020
Powertrain Architecture FHEV (Full Hybrid Electric Vehicle)
Body type SUV, Crossover
Seats 5
Doors 5
Fuel consumption (urban) 3.4-3.8 l/100 km (69.2 – 61.9 US mpg)
Fuel consumption (extra urban) 3.7-4 l/100 km (63.6 – 58.8 US mpg)
Fuel consumption (combined) 3.5-3.8 l/100 km (67.2 – 61.9 US mpg)
Fuel Type Petrol (Gasoline)
Weight-to-power ratio 10.8 kg/Hp
Weight-to-torque ratio 10.4 kg/Nm
Gross battery capacity 0.76 kWh
Battery voltage 177.6 V
Battery technology Lithium-ion (Li-Ion)
Battery location Under the rear seats
Electric motor power (1) 80 Hp
Electric motor torque (1) 141 Nm (104 lb.-ft.)
Electric motor location (1) Integrated into the transmission
Electric motor power (2) 5 Hp
Electric motor torque (2) 52 Nm (38.35 lb.-ft.)
Electric motor location (2) Rear axle, Transverse
System power 116 Hp
Engine Power 91 Hp @ 5500 rpm
Engine Torque 120 Nm @ 3800-4800 rpm (88.51 lb.-ft. @ 3800-4800 rpm)
Engine layout Front, Transverse
Engine Model/Code M15A-FXE
Engine displacement 1490 cm3 (90.93 cu. in.)
Number of cylinders 3
Engine configuration Inline
Cylinder Bore 80.49 mm (3.17 in.)
Piston Stroke 97.61 mm (3.84 in.)
Fuel injection system Multi-port manifold injection
Engine aspiration Naturally aspirated engine
Engine oil capacity 3.6 l (3.8 US qt | 3.17 UK qt)
Coolant capacity 4.7 l (4.97 US qt | 4.14 UK qt)
Kerb Weight 1250-1270 kg (2755.78 – 2799.87 lbs.)
Max. weight 1525-1545 kg (3362.05 – 3406.14 lbs.)
Max load 275 kg (606.27 lbs.)
Fuel tank capacity 36 l (9.51 US gal | 7.92 UK gal)
Length 4180 mm (164.57 in.)
Width 1765 mm (69.49 in.)
Height 1590 mm (62.6 in.)
Wheelbase 2560 mm (100.79 in.)
Front track 1515-1525 mm (59.65 – 60.04 in.)
Rear track 1510-1520 mm (59.45 – 59.84 in.)
Ride height (ground clearance) 170 mm (6.69 in.)
Minimum turning circle 10.6 m (34.78 ft.)
Drivetrain Architecture ICE drives front wheels, electric motors drive front and rear wheels.
Drive wheel All wheel drive (4×4)
Number of gears and type of gearbox automatic transmission ECVT
Front suspension Independent type McPherson
Rear suspension Torsion
Front brakes Ventilated discs
Rear brakes Disc
Assisting systems ABS (Anti-lock braking system)
Steering type Steering rack and pinion
Power steering Hydraulic Steering
Tires size 215/50 R18
Wheel rims size 18
